    Found this recipe for mulled cider. Thought you could wrap the spices in muslin, with instruction label and add to your basket.

    Hot Mulled Cider

    1/2 cup Brown sugar
    1 dash Salt
    2 quarts Cider
    1 teaspoon Whole allspice
    1 teaspoon Whole cloves
    1 three-inch stick cinnamon
    1 dash Nutmeg

    Combine sugar, salt, and cider. Tie spices in cheese cloth. Add to cider. Slowly bring to a boil. Cover and simmer 20 minutes. Remove spices. Serve hot with orange slice floaters and cinnamon stick.
